Types of Subdivision Bonds
Separate between the various kinds of subdivision bonds to establish which finest suits your task's needs. There are three major kinds of neighborhood bonds frequently utilized in the realty industry: Performance bonds, payment bonds, and maintenance bonds.
Performance bonds make certain that the developer finishes the subdivision according to the accepted plans and laws. If the developer stops working to do so, the bond will cover the costs to finish the task. Payment bonds assure that all subcontractors and distributors are paid for their service the community. If the programmer defaults on repayments, this bond offers monetary defense to those events. Upkeep bonds, on the other hand, make certain that the designer maintains the community infrastructure for a given duration after completion. This bond covers any type of fixings or upkeep needed throughout that time.
Comprehending the distinctions between these kinds of subdivision bonds is critical in choosing the most appropriate one for your details job needs. Each type serves a distinctive function and provides different kinds of protection, so it's essential to examine your task's needs meticulously before making a decision.
